A roadmap to developing energy-efficient MAC protocol in wireless sensor networks: a case of ADP-MAC development and implementation

  • Shama Siddiqui Department of Computer Science, DHA Suffa University, Karachi Pakistan
  • Anwar Ahmed Khan Department of Computer Science, Millennium Institute of Technology and Entrepreneurship, Karachi Pakistan
  • Sayeed Ghani Department of Computer Science, University of North Carolina at Chapel Hill, United States of America
Keywords: Road-Map, MAC, Protocol, ADP-MAC, SCP-MAC, T-AAD

Abstract

Over the past two decades, hundreds of protocols have been developed for diversified applications of WSN corresponding to different layers in the communication stack. Among these, Media Access Control (MAC) layer protocols are of great interest due to providing possibility of optimizing performance parameters. Despite availability of a large number of survey articles, there remains a gap for a tutorial that offers guidelines about the development process of MAC protocol. In this paper, we present a detailed tutorial for developing a MAC protocol starting from the stage of research gap identification and ending at the performance evaluation. We described the journey of development and implementation of a novel asynchronous MAC protocol ADP-MAC (Adaptive and Dynamic Polling MAC) as a case study. ADP-MAC was developed by deploying a novel concept of channel polling interval distributions, and was compared against Synchronized Channel Polling- MAC (SCP-MAC) and lightweight Traffic Auto-Adaptation based MAC (T-AAD). Finally, we proposed major milestones of protocol development along with recommendations about publishing the research.

Published
2023-01-01